#ff1460 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ff1460 is composed of 100% red, 7.8%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 92.2% magenta, 62.4%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 340.6 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 53.9%. #ff1460 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ff28c0 with #ff0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0066.

#ff1460 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ff1460 has RGB values of R:255, G:20,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.92, Y:0.62, K:0. Its decimal value is 16716896.
